Sticking the tongue out, or tongue protrusion, refers to the involuntary or repetitive action of extending the tongue outside the mouth. This behavior can occur for various reasons and is commonly seen in children as part of normal development or in response to concentration, such as when focusing on a task. However, frequent or persistent tongue protrusion can indicate underlying medical or neurological conditions. In some cases, it may be a sign of a tic disorder, where involuntary muscle movements or vocalizations occur. Neurological conditions such as cerebral palsy, Down syndrome, or autism spectrum disorder (ASD) can also lead to tongue protrusion due to difficulties with muscle control or sensory processing. Additionally, certain medications, especially antipsychotics, can cause tardive dyskinesia, a condition characterized by involuntary movements, including sticking the tongue out.
Treatment for sticking the tongue out depends on identifying and addressing the underlying cause. For developmental or behavioral causes, understanding the context and triggers can help in managing the behavior. Behavioral interventions, such as positive reinforcement and redirection, can be effective in encouraging alternative behaviors. For neurological conditions, speech therapy and occupational therapy may help improve muscle control and address sensory processing issues. If tongue protrusion is related to medication side effects, consulting with a healthcare provider to adjust the medication or explore alternatives is necessary. In cases where tics are present, behavioral therapies like habit reversal training may help manage the symptoms. It is important to consult with healthcare professionals for an accurate diagnosis and to develop a comprehensive treatment plan tailored to the individual's specific needs.
